Responsibilities

  • Perform patient assessments, including vital signs, medical history, and chief complaints.
  • Prepare patients for medical examinations and assist healthcare providers during procedures.
  • Triage patients.
  • Venipuncture - draws blood.
  • Ensure that all patients are brought into the examination room within 15 minutes of being checked into the clinic.
  • Scans all documents from the patient's records into the system.
  • Assists physician in any procedure, or lab requests.
  • Prepares patient charts 24 hours before patients are seen.
  • Answers all patients’ messages in a timely manner.
  • Receives requests for refills and processes them within 24 hours of the request.
  • Reviews the fax server daily and carefully uploads them to the correct patient's file.
  • Maintains prescribed medication room organized and clean.
  • Maintains examining rooms organized and stocked.
  • Maintains the Lab & Procedures room organized.
  • Keeps correct inventory levels of all medical supplies.
  • Performs all HEDIS measures for new and existing patients.
  • Helps other team members as needed.
  • Performs routine laboratory tests on patients as provided by established protocol.
  • Maintains nursing stations and examination areas in a manner consistent with OSHA standards and universal precautions procedures.
  • Maintains inventory of medical supplies and materials.
  • Receives and screens telephone calls.
  • Coordinates patient flow.
  • Maintains office/department and patient records.
  • Prepares timely, legible, and complete documentation of all patient care as provided by law, regulation, and established policy.
  • Participates in quality improvement and utilization review activities.
  • Participates in continuing education to continually improve skills and abilities and stay abreast of current technologies/practices.
  • Applies safety principles as identified by established policy.
  • Ensures compliance with legal issues including but not limited to patient confidentiality and risk management; ensures compliance with federal, state, and local regulations.
  • Exhibits a high degree of courtesy, tact, and poise when interacting with patients, families, and other healthcare professionals.
  • Adjusts to fluctuating peaks in patient flow, acuity, and other operational demands while maintaining quality.
  • Performs other related duties as assigned by management.
  • Assists any provider within the practice.
  • Helps training new MA
